Crafting the Perfect Job Description

Importance of Clarity and Inclusivity

A well-crafted job description is the cornerstone of effective HR hiring. It should clearly articulate the role, responsibilities, and qualifications, ensuring it’s accessible and inclusive to attract a diverse pool of candidates. Clarity in job descriptions helps potential applicants understand what’s expected, while inclusivity widens your search to a more diverse talent pool, enriching your organization’s culture and capabilities.

How to Highlight Your Company Culture

Your job description is also a chance to showcase your company culture. Highlighting aspects such as teamwork, innovation, and work-life balance can make your organization more attractive to potential hires. Use this space to communicate your values and what makes your company a unique place to work.

Leveraging Social Media and Professional Networks

Strategies for Reaching Out to Potential Candidates

Social media and professional networks are invaluable tools for reaching potential candidates. Strategies include posting job openings on platforms like LinkedIn, Twitter, and industry-specific forums. Engaging content that showcases your company culture and employee testimonials can also attract passive candidates who are not actively looking but are open to opportunities.

The Role of LinkedIn, Twitter, and Industry-Specific Forums

LinkedIn serves as a primary tool for professional networking and job postings, while Twitter can amplify your reach with hashtags related to your industry or hiring campaigns. Industry-specific forums and online communities are perfect for targeting candidates with specialized skills, offering a more focused approach to sourcing talent.

Conducting Effective Interviews

Techniques for Insightful Questioning

Effective interviews go beyond assessing technical skills; they explore how a candidate fits within your team and company culture. Techniques include behavioral interview questions that ask candidates to describe past experiences and challenges, providing insight into their problem-solving and interpersonal skills.

Assessing Candidate Fit Beyond Technical Skills

Assessing a candidate’s fit involves considering their potential for growth, adaptability, and how they align with the company’s values and culture. This holistic approach ensures that hires contribute positively to the team’s dynamics and the organization’s long-term goals.

The Role of Technology in Modern HR Hiring

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S)

ATS can streamline the recruitment process by automating the sorting and ranking of resumes, helping HR professionals focus on candidates who best match the job requirements. This technology improves efficiency and helps reduce unconscious bias in the initial screening stages.

AI and Machine Learning for Candidate Screening

AI and machine learning offer advanced tools for analyzing resumes and identifying the most promising candidates. These technologies can also assist in predictive analysis, helping forecast a candidate’s success in a role based on their skills, experiences, and job performance trends.

Building a Candidate Pipeline

Strategies for Maintaining a Reservoir of Potential Hires

Creating a candidate pipeline involves nurturing relationships with potential candidates even when there are no current openings. This strategy ensures you have a pool of qualified individuals to reach out to when positions become available, reducing the time-to-hire and improving the quality of candidates.

Engaging Past Applicants

Past applicants, especially those who reached the final stages of previous hiring processes, can be valuable assets to your candidate pipeline. Re-engaging these individuals when new opportunities arise can expedite the hiring process and improve candidate experience.

Employee Referrals: Tapping into Your Team’s Network

Incentivizing Referrals

Employee referral programs can significantly enhance your recruitment efforts. Offering incentives for successful hires encourages employees to refer qualified candidates, tapping into their professional networks and potentially reducing hiring costs.

Ensuring Diversity Through Referral Programs

While referral programs are effective, it’s crucial to ensure they don’t compromise your diversity goals. Encouraging employees to refer candidates from a variety of backgrounds helps maintain a diverse and inclusive workforce.

Onboarding and Retention

Best Practices for Integrating New Hires into Your Team

A structured onboarding process is essential for integrating new hires. This includes clear communication of job expectations, introduction to team members, and providing resources for professional growth. A positive onboarding experience can significantly impact an employee’s ability to integrate and contribute to the team.

Strategies for Retaining Talent Long-Term

Retaining top talent requires ongoing effort. Strategies include providing competitive compensation, opportunities for career advancement, recognition programs, and fostering a positive work environment. Regular check-ins and feedback sessions also help identify and address any concerns early on, enhancing employee satisfaction and retention.
